Note for external plugin authors integrating with the Parcelwise tracking webhook: as of this quarter, delivery events are batched every 90 seconds rather than sent individually, so plugins must tolerate out-of-order status codes. Retries follow exponential backoff for 24 hours, after which events are dropped. Please validate signatures on every payload; unsigned batches will be rejected starting next release. Sandbox credentials are issued per vendor. For onboarding questions or sandbox resets, write to the integrations desk.

billing contact of tahaf-kafop = istwyn_fraox@norvaworks.corp

Ticket: ARCH-2241 — Signature check failed on cold-storage archive job

The nightly job that archives cold storage buckets at Норбранд (Norbrand) failed its signature verification step last night: the archiver refused manifest bundle v417 because it was signed with the retired Q2 key. New team members: this happens whenever a rotation lands mid-cycle — the archiver caches the old public key until restart. Restart the archiver pod, then re-sign the manifest and rerun. Re-signing must use the current archive signing key, shown below.

rollout seal: bky4_x7Gc

Gross margin across the Hollowfield branch network came in at 41.2%, down 1.8 points from Q1. The decline traces mainly to freight surcharges and heavier discounting on the Arbor line. The Selmont and Vairley branches outperformed, largely through better mix on service contracts. Corrective actions: tighten discount approvals, renegotiate carrier terms, and shift promotion budget toward higher-margin SKUs. Branch-level detail is attached in the workbook. The following confidential note outlines how this feeds our forward plan.

board note of kageg-bahof: The renewal with Holwynax Holdings closes at $2 million a year, 5 percent below the last contract. Project Ulaath slips by two quarters because of the supplier delay.